Food Chemistry, 2007
Composition, functional properties and antioxidative activity of a protein hydrolysate prepared from defatted round scad (Decapterus maruadsi) mince, using Flavourzyme, with a degree of hydrolysis (DH) of 60%, were determined. The protein hydrolysate had a high protein content (48.0%) and a high ash content (24.56%). It was brownish yellow in colour (L∗

Further record of Ceratothoa carinata (Isopoda: Cymothoidae) parasitic on Decapterus maruadsi in Japanese waters [PDF]
The cymothoid isopod Ceratothoa carinata (Bianconi, 1869) was found in the buccal cavity of the Japanese scad Decapterus maruadsi (Temminck & Schlegel, 1843) from the western Seto Inland Sea. This parasite is likely to be common in some local populations of D. maruadsi in Japanese waters.

Food Chemistry, 2007
The effects of muscle types and washing on the properties of a protein-based film from round scad (Decapterus maruadsi) mince were investigated. Washing resulted in an increase in the protein content with a coincidental decrease in the fat content of mince, especially from whole muscle and dark muscle.
